Smokeshow Mixology is a brand in the mixology and cocktail space, with an audience that responds to content, not discounts. They came to us with a working store but an email program that wasn't adding revenue to the business.
- No fixed email plan or sending calendar
- Simple, repetitive campaign designs with no real variation
- No educational content in the program, without angles
- Deliverability issues capping inbox placement and open rates
- No clear strategy for the channel
- Build strategy and calendar for the email channel
- Improve campaign design quality and variety
- Add educational content to the campaign mix
- Fix deliverability
- Take day-to-day execution off the internal team
We audited their email program, and ran our retention playbook built for brands that need structure and direction.
- Built a monthly campaign calendar planned in advance.
- Redesigned every template to match the brand voice.
- Added diverse angles to the email content.
- Cleaned up deliverability through segmentation and list hygiene.
